Agent Odell (Bill Duke) made it quite clear the Pierce family has an important role to play in the impending war with Markovia in the finale of 'Black Lightning' Season 2. Now in the third season's premiere, he has made it clear the Pierces aren't just important because of their metahuman abilities but also because of their scientific skill. 

When the Markovians stage an attack on an A.S.A holding facility, Odell puts Jefferson Pierce/Black Lightning (Cress Williams) and his ex-wife Doctor Lynn Stewart (Christine Adams) in protective custody. He makes it clear that while Black Lightning is most certainly a valuable asset, Dr. Stewart is actually more important to the A.S.A and her safety is of prime concern to the organization. 

Thanks to her work with Green Light and the metahuman pod kids, Lynn is one of the foremost experts on metahuman biology. If the Markovians were to capture her and put her to work on building up their army of metas, it could change the tide of the war and ensure a Markovian victory. 

Bill Duke as Agent Odell in Black Lightning (YouTube/TheCW)

The Markovians have already captured Dr. Helga Jace (Jennifer Riker), the only other scientist with as much experience dealing with metas, and are presumably using her to create new metahumans for their army. If the foreign invaders were to capture Lynn and add her expertise to their project as well, there would be no stopping them from becoming the most powerful nation on the planet. 

Of course, the A.S.A have their own agenda in the Markovian conflict and they will undoubtedly try to use Lynn and her family for their own purposes. We already know that the United States government has had its own metahuman soldiers for a while with two of them, Commander Carson Williams (Christopher B. Duncan) and the unstable former soldier Cyclotronic/Ned Creegan (Chase Anderson), having made appearances in Season 3's first episode.

With Lynn's help, the A.S.A could easily find a way to create even more metas and control the ones they already have access to, which would undoubtedly mean bad news for Freeland and the Pierce family.
